Show Notes
Kicking off season four is The Housemaid — and its brand-new film adaptation. We revisit Millie’s tense, twisted experience working inside the Winchesters’ home before unpacking how the movie brings that psychological tension to the screen. We compare what worked (and what didn’t), talk casting and those jaw-dropping twists, and debate whether the book or the film tells this story best.
